Filmmaker Statement

Concrete Denizens is a short documentary that explores the inclusive skateboard scene developing in Brisbane. It's a discussion of what skateboarding brings to individuals and their community. Featuring music from local Brisbane bands, this documentary is a celebration of art, sport and a community built on concrete. The documentary features interviews with female skateboarders from the We Skate QLD community group, a crew dedicated to diversifying South East Queensland’s skateboarding community. It also features interviews with Skatewell Coach group and Ben Ventress, founder of Project Distribution, one of the most respected distribution houses in skateboarding, and sponsor of the most talented skateboarders in the country.
